Your employer may have a wellness program available that can reduce the cost of health insurance. A lot of employers give out incentives for their employees in order to have their lifestyle and health assessed. You may be able to join a fitness program afterwards, which will help the company to save money on their insurance coverage, and that in turn would lower your own premium.

When it’s time for open enrollment, evaluate your needs when it comes to health insurance. Although your current policy may have been effective thus far, that may no longer be the case because health situations for you or your dependents may have changed. You might also need a different policy in order to add new people to it. Open enrollment is also the time to make changes to dental and vision insurance coverage if your employer offers that.

TIP! If you don’t see the doctor that much, you should most likely get a Health Savings Account, or HSA. Any dollars you save towards deductibles, premiums and copays can get saved in an HSA and applied towards future medical expenses.

If your spouse has a health insurance possibility through an employer, you may have to pay a surcharge to add your wife or husband on your plan. It may be less expensive for each of you to get coverage through your own workplaces, so do the calculations to find out which is best.
